
Age: 37
Title: Partner
Workplace: Morris, Nichols, Arsht & Tunnell LLP
Jason Russell is a partner at one of Delaware’s most prominent law firms. He handles some of the most challenging and noteworthy cases related to commercial law and Delaware’s economy at large. His clients include world-renowned companies and major Delaware businesses with strong ties to the local economy. Through his experience, Russell has become the go-to counsel for nonprofit organizations around the United States looking to establish Delaware entities as investment vehicles, such as solar and wind projects, the rehabilitation of historic buildings, and low-income housing. Russell is also chair of the Delaware State Bar Association’s Commercial Law Section, focusing on maintaining Delaware’s reputation as a leading jurisdiction for entity formation and commercial law.
In addition to his work with the Delaware State Bar Association, Russell is actively involved with the Sanford School in Hockessin, and he regularly participates in local charity events, such as the Drive for Autism and the Legend Foundation (for breast cancer awareness). As an avid runner and obstacle course racer, he frequently participates in races for local charities in Delaware and Pennsylvania.
